

Toy Cars: Crazy Racing 3D Game Overview
Start your tiny engine and prepare for oversized racing madness in Toy Cars: Crazy Racing 3D, a colorful arcade racing game where miniature vehicles battle across imaginative tracks packed with ramps, speed boosters, hazards, shortcuts, and unpredictable power-ups. Winning requires more than holding the accelerator because every race can change within seconds when rockets begin flying, traps cover the road, and a perfectly timed boost sends another driver into first place.
Developed by Kagari Games, Toy Cars: Crazy Racing 3D combines the accessible controls of a casual car game with the competitive excitement of kart racing. Instead of realistic motorsport rules, the game embraces playful chaos and gives racers plenty of ways to interfere with their opponents. You can protect yourself with a shield, attack the leading vehicle, leave slippery surprises behind, or grab extra speed when you need to close the distance.
The environments are another major part of the experience. Rather than racing repeatedly around ordinary circuits, you'll travel through imaginative locations inspired by candy worlds, orchards, futuristic cities, snowy mountains, volcanic landscapes, and sunny European scenery. Each location introduces its own personality and obstacles, making progression feel like a road trip through a giant toy universe. 🚗🏁

How To Play Toy Cars: Crazy Racing 3D?
On a desktop computer, use WASD or the Arrow Keys to accelerate, brake, and steer your vehicle. Press Space when you need to jump, and activate your current power-up using E or a mouse click. If your vehicle becomes stuck or you need to return to the course, press R to respawn.
Mobile players receive touchscreen controls, with steering positioned toward the left side of the display and important actions such as braking, jumping, and power-up activation available on the right.
Once the race begins, concentrate on maintaining a smooth racing line while watching for glowing booster panels, ramps, coins, mystery boxes, and dangerous obstacles.
Drive through mystery boxes whenever possible to receive a random ability. Depending on what you obtain, you may want to use it immediately or save it for a more important moment.
Collect coins during the race whenever doing so does not require abandoning a much faster route. The better your final position, the greater your potential reward, and winning a course allows you to continue progressing toward the next racing environment.
Tips And Tricks For Better Gameplay
Learn each track instead of treating every race as completely random. Knowing where ramps, boosters, sharp corners, and major hazards appear gives you a significant advantage over rivals.
Try to drive through boost panels while maintaining control. Extra acceleration is useful only when you can keep the car on the fastest part of the course afterward.
Collect mystery boxes whenever they are reasonably close to your racing line because even one good power up can change your position dramatically.
Don't immediately activate every item you receive. A shield may become much more valuable near the finish line, while an offensive power up can be particularly effective when the leading racer is beginning to escape.
Use jumps strategically. They can help you avoid hazards and navigate tricky sections, but unnecessary jumping may interfere with your racing rhythm.
Coins are valuable, but victory matters too. Avoid making a huge detour for a single coin when doing so could cost several racing positions. Finally, remain focused after making a mistake. Arcade races can change very quickly, and a player in last place may still recover with a combination of boosters, clever driving, and useful power-ups.
